OVERCOMING THE ILLUSION OF LONELINESS

Almost everyone experiences at some time the feeling of loneliness. Even if we have family, friends, and other good conditions, we can still feel isolated or misunderstood and suffer from loneliness; yearning to feel a deeper sense of connection with others. At times the weight of loneliness can feel immense and difficult to overcome.

Using Buddhist teachings and meditations, we can heal our feelings of loneliness by recognizing that the perception of ourselves as separate from others is an illusion. In truth, we are all naturally and profoundly interconnected. By learning to understand and feel this connection we will reduce our sense of isolation. In this way we can allow a natural closeness and authentic love for others to arise even if we find ourselves at times physically alone.

What To Expect

There are two sessions in each workshop. They consist of an introduction, simple breathing meditation and teaching and conclude with a contemplative meditation on the teaching from that session.

Buddhist meditation involves staying alert and keeping our back straight, so we sit on chairs for the duration of the course. There’s no need to bring anything, although you may wish to bring some water and a jacket. Refreshments are provided in the break session.

Attendees come from all walks of life and there’s no need to have any meditation experience as all meditations are guided.  Everyone is welcome.
